Not necessarily. A state's capital city is not always the most populated area of the state. In fact, the most populated city in a state is usually NOT the state capitol. Many (but not all) capital cities were the most populated in their state at the time they joined the union, which was over 100 years ago for most states. Over time things change.

NYC is its largest city in New York, while the capital is Albany.

Alaska capital is Juneau, not Anchorage or Nome

Texas capital is Austin, not Houston or Dallas

California capital is Sacramento, not Los Angeles or San Francisco

Pennsylvania capital is Harrisburg, not Philadelphia

Illinois capital is Springfield, not Chicago

Michigan capital is Lansing, not Detroit

Florida capital is Tallahassee, not Miami

Minnesota capital is St. Paul, not Minneapolis

Montana capital is Helena, not Billings
